What a Neon Sign Transformer Does
A neon sign transformer converts standard electrical current into the high voltage needed to illuminate neon tubing. Neon signs require significantly higher voltages than standard household electrical systems, which is why the transformer is essential to the sign’s operation.
Without a properly functioning transformer, the neon tubing cannot maintain stable illumination. Older neon signs often use heavier iron-core transformers, while newer systems may rely on electronic power supplies. Both types eventually wear down, especially when exposed to outdoor conditions such as heat, humidity, moisture, and storms.
Because these systems operate under high voltage, electrical problems should always be handled carefully and inspected by trained professionals.
Flickering Is Often an Early Warning Sign
One of the most common signs of transformer trouble is flickering.
If a neon sign starts blinking randomly, dimming temporarily, or struggling to maintain steady brightness, the transformer may no longer be delivering consistent voltage. In some cases, the sign may turn on properly at first but begin flickering after operating for a short period.
Flickering can also be caused by loose wiring or aging tubing, which is why accurate diagnosis matters. However, failing transformers are frequently responsible for unstable illumination.
The longer the flickering continues, the more strain may be placed on other electrical components within the sign system.
Gradual Dimming Can Point to Transformer Problems
A weakening transformer often loses efficiency over time. As the voltage output becomes less stable, the neon tubing may slowly appear dimmer than it once did.
This dimming sometimes happens gradually enough that business owners do not notice it immediately. The sign may still function, but its brightness and visual impact continue declining over time.
Some signs also begin to show uneven illumination, where one section appears bright while another appears dimmer or unstable. This can indicate the transformer is no longer distributing power consistently throughout the system.

Buzzing or Crackling Sounds Should Not Be Ignored
Some older transformers naturally produce a soft humming sound during operation. However, unusually loud buzzing, crackling, or electrical noises can indicate internal transformer problems.
These sounds may suggest several possible issues:
- Internal electrical arcing
- Failing insulation
- Loose electrical components
- Voltage instability
- Excessive heat buildup
Electrical arcing is particularly concerning because it can create safety hazards if left unresolved.
If a transformer suddenly becomes much louder than usual, it should be inspected by a professional rather than ignored.
Overheating Is a Serious Warning Sign
Transformers naturally generate some heat while operating, but excessive heat can indicate internal failure or electrical overload.
If the transformer housing feels unusually hot or produces a burning smell, the sign should be shut down immediately until it can be evaluated safely.
Overheating can damage wiring, shorten the sign’s lifespan, and pose a fire risk if left unchecked.

Difficulty Starting the Sign Can Indicate Failure
Another common symptom of transformer failure is difficulty turning the sign on.
A failing transformer may struggle to generate the high-voltage pulse needed to initially illuminate the neon tubing. This can create situations where the sign:
- Starts slowly
- Only partially lights up
- Works intermittently
- Requires repeated power cycling
- Stops working entirely after startup attempts
Some business owners notice the sign working properly on certain days but failing unpredictably on others. Intermittent operation is often one of the clearest signs that the transformer is deteriorating.
Burning Smells or Visible Damage Require Immediate Attention
Any burning smell near a neon sign should be taken seriously.
Over time, insulation inside the transformer can deteriorate due to age, moisture exposure, or prolonged heat buildup. When this happens, internal short circuits or overheating may occur.
Visible warning signs may include scorched wiring, cracked transformer housing, corrosion, melted insulation, or blackened connection points.
Outdoor signs are particularly vulnerable because moisture intrusion can significantly accelerate electrical deterioration.
If any visible damage appears around the transformer or electrical system, the sign should be powered down until it can be inspected by a professional.
Ozone Smells Can Signal Electrical Arcing
A strong ozone smell near a neon sign can sometimes indicate transformer or wiring issues.
Many people describe ozone as having a sharp, electrical smell similar to chlorine or the air after a lightning storm. This odor is often associated with electrical arcing or insulation breakdown.
While mild ozone odors occasionally occur around older neon systems, persistent or strong odors should never be ignored.
Electrical arcing can worsen over time and may eventually damage the transformer further or create additional safety concerns.

Transformer Issues Are Sometimes Misdiagnosed
One reason transformer problems are frequently overlooked is that their symptoms often resemble damaged neon tubing.
Both issues may cause flickering, dim lighting, dark sections, or intermittent operation. However, replacing tubing without addressing the transformer problem may not solve the issue.
Proper diagnosis usually involves evaluating the transformer, wiring, electrical connections, and the condition of the tubing itself.
